Fig. 4: Molecular characterization and herbicide resistance of PagALS base-edited poplar plants.
From: Synergistic optimization enhancing the precision and efficiency of cytosine base editors in poplar

a Representative sequencing chromatograms showing various Pro197 mutations in PagALS homologs. Mutations include amino acid substitutions, deletions, and premature stop codons. “Ref” indicates the reference sequence. b P197 amino acid changes across PagALS homologs (A01, A02, G01, G02) in different edited plant lines. Plants are grouped based on the number of successfully edited homologs. c Time-course comparison of the edited line 1#58 and wild-type (WT) potted plants treated with 3000 mg/L tribenuron. Images show plant status before treatment and 30 days after herbicide application, with close-up images of leaf morphology at the 30-day timepoint. Scale bar represents 10 cm. d In vivo herbicide resistance assay comparing growth of edited (1#58) and WT tissue-cultured seedlings after 30 days of culture on medium supplemented with 0.5 mg/L nicosulfuron. Terminal bud and stem segment growth are displayed. Scale bar represents 1 cm.
